Buffalo Creek String and, an old-time country quartet from Concord, makes its first performance at Fountain General Store this coming Friday night.

Buffalo Creek is fronted by Annie Griffey and Joy Moser, whose harmonies highlight their covers of old-timey country classics by such artists as the Carter Family, Kitty Wells, Hazel Dickens, and Ola Belle Reed.

The band includes Jackie Burgess on fiddle and banjo, Griffey on bass; Moser on guitar, bass and Dobro; and Scott Dixon on banjo, mandolin, and guitar.

Burgess and Griffey performed together in the Stanly County Boys. Moser and Dixon were formerly in the Cold Creek Ramblers.

Their debut CD, Weary Woman Blues, boasts “solid instrumental sound,” according to the Old-Time Herald: “well-done” its reviewer said.
